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
16844624 0251704087 38796514480
95738582 584275336
95738582 584275336
39097 96951768198 010065088
All about undefined
Interested in learning more?
95738582 584275336
39097 96951768198 010065088
See more
8544432 997518377 91400979313
63 45856378 01 72
See more
4040 8797 4050
36620519 0413954024 0673
See more